demand orientation: accurate positioning of positions and target talents
to employ foreign employees, business needs should be taken as the core, and the core competence of positions and talent portrait should be clearly defined. For example, technical research and development positions can focus on scientific and technological talent-intensive areas such as Europe, America and India, focusing on the professional background, project experience and innovation ability of candidates; language positions need to combine business coverage countries, and give priority to native speakers or candidates with cross-cultural communication skills. Enterprises can choose recruitment channels according to job characteristics: high-end talents can be attracted through industry summits and academic cooperation. Basic positions can quickly reach the target population with the help of localized recruitment platforms or labor cooperation organizations. Accurate positioning can not only improve the efficiency of recruitment, but also reduce the risk of talent and job adaptation.
compliance-based: avoiding legal and policy risks in the whole process
the compliance of cross-border recruitment is the bottom line that enterprises must adhere. Different countries have strict regulations on work visas, labor rights, data privacy, etc. for foreign employees. Enterprises need to cooperate with local legal institutions or professional service providers in advance to ensure that the process is legal and compliant. For example, in the visa application stage, it is necessary to make clear whether the post conforms to the foreign talent introduction policy and prepare complete qualification documents; in the contract signing stage, it is necessary to follow the local labor law and clarify the salary structure, working hours and termination terms; in the information management stage, it is necessary to strictly abide by the data protection regulations to avoid disputes caused by information disclosure. Compliance management can not only protect the rights and interests of enterprises, but also enhance the trust of foreign employees in enterprises.
cultural integration: building an inclusive team environment
cultural differences may become hidden barriers to teamwork after foreign employees enter the job. Enterprises need to promote deep integration through the following ways:
- induction adaptation plan : provide cross-cultural communication training, interpretation of corporate values and business process guidance to help foreign employees integrate quickly;
- mentor support mechanism : arrange employees who are familiar with Chinese and foreign cultures to serve as mentors, assist in solving work and life problems;
- team activity design : organize multi-cultural theme activities, such as international food festival, language exchange day, etc., to enhance team cohesion.
In addition, companies can implement flexible telecommuting policies, provide religious holiday support or language learning subsidies, and show respect for cultural diversity.
Technology Empowerment: Digital Tools Enhance Recruitment and Management Effectiveness
Digital technology is reshaping transnational recruitment and management models. For example, AI interview system can realize multilingual real-time translation and intelligent evaluation, shorten the recruitment cycle; big data analysis can accurately match job requirements and candidate background, improve decision-making efficiency; block chain technology can verify the authenticity of academic qualifications and work experience, reduce the risk of information asymmetry. In terms of employee management, enterprises can achieve efficient communication between multinational teams through the cloud collaboration platform, use the performance management system to track the work progress of foreign employees, and optimize talent development strategies through data analysis.
brand building: creating global employer attraction
in the global talent competition, the enterprise employer brand is the core competitiveness to attract foreign employees. Enterprises need to convey their own advantages through multiple channels:
- international platform display : publish enterprise globalization cases, employee growth stories and social responsibility practices on international recruitment platforms such as LinkedIn and Indeed;
- social media interaction : use Facebook, Twitter and other channels to share corporate culture, team activities and industry trends to enhance brand affinity;
- industry influence construction : through participating in international exhibitions, publishing technical white papers or holding industry forums, enhance the visibility of enterprises in the global market.
In addition, providing a clear career path, competitive salary and benefits, and an open and inclusive corporate culture can significantly enhance the attractiveness of foreign talents.
Long-term retention: focus on talent growth and win-win situation
hiring foreign employees is not only a short-term recruitment behavior, but also part of a long-term talent strategy. Enterprises need to provide continuous career development support for foreign employees, such as setting up international job rotation mechanism, providing cross-cultural leadership training, encouraging participation in global projects, etc. At the same time, establish a transparent performance evaluation system and feedback mechanism to make foreign employees feel fair and respected. In addition, paying attention to the family needs of foreign employees (such as children's education and spouse employment support) can also enhance their willingness to stay and achieve the common growth of talents and enterprises.
